What Is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online gaming site that accepts cryptocurrency-- such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, or stablecoins-- as a main kind of payment. Unlike conventional online casinos that depend on fiat currencies and centralized payment processors, a crypto casino leverages blockchain innovation to assist in deposits, wagers, and withdrawals. A number of these platforms also host video games whose results are verifiable on the blockchain, including a layer of transparency that conventional operators often lack.
How a Crypto Casino WorksAccount Creation-- Players register by generating a username and password, frequently with no individual information needed (a practice known as "KYC‑free" registration). Wallet Integration-- The platform supplies a distinct wallet address or incorporates with external crypto wallets (e.g., MetaMask). Gamers move funds from their personal wallet to the casino's hot or cold wallet. Bet Placement-- Games are used in 2 primary formats: Provably Fair Games-- Cryptographic algorithms let players verify each hand or spin's fairness. Timeless RNG Games-- Standard random number generators are used, however the platform still settling in crypto.Payouts-- Winnings are credited to the gamer's on‑site wallet and can be withdrawn directly to a blockchain address.
